📜  Teradata和PouchDB之间的区别(1)

📅  最后修改于: 2023-12-03 15:05:34.170000             🧑  作者: Mango

Teradata和PouchDB之间的区别

Teradata和PouchDB都是数据库管理系统,但它们的设计目的、功能、运行环境以及适用场景等方面都有所不同。

设计目的

Teradata是企业级数据仓库解决方案,旨在处理大量复杂的数据。它支持海量数据的存储、处理和分析,并提供了强大的数据集成、数据分析和数据可视化的功能。

PouchDB则是一种轻量级的本地数据库,适用于在Web和移动应用中存储和管理数据。它可以在浏览器、Node.js和移动设备等各种平台上运行,支持跨平台数据同步和离线数据访问等特性。

功能

Teradata拥有丰富的功能,包括数据存储、数据管理、数据分析、数据挖掘、数据可视化等。它能够对多种类型的数据进行复杂的查询与处理,并支持高速数据加载、数据备份、数据恢复等重要功能。

PouchDB虽然是一种轻量级的本地数据库,但也具备了一些重要的功能,如索引、事务、数据复制等。它还支持复杂查询和地理空间查询等高级功能,可以通过插件扩展更多功能。

运行环境

Teradata是一种客户端-服务器架构的数据库系统,需要安装在专门的服务器上。它需要强大的硬件支持,如多处理器、高速存储器和大容量存储器等。

PouchDB则可以在客户端或者服务器端运行,不需要特殊的硬件和软件环境。它可以和多种Web和移动应用框架配合使用,如Angular、React、Vue、Ionic等。

适用场景

Teradata适用于需要处理海量、复杂数据的企业级应用场景,如金融、保险、医疗、物流等行业。它可以帮助企业快速、精确地分析数据,提高业务决策效率和精度。

PouchDB适用于需要在Web和移动应用中管理数据的场景。它可以作为浏览器端的本地数据库,实现数据的高速存储和查询。它也可以作为移动端应用的本地数据库,实现离线数据存储和同步。同时,PouchDB还支持与服务器端数据库进行同步和数据复制,实现端到端的数据同步。

结论

Teradata和PouchDB都是很好的数据库管理系统,但它们的设计目的、功能、运行环境以及适用场景等方面都有所不同。开发者们可以根据自己项目的需求来选择最符合自己的数据库系统。

# Teradata和PouchDB之间的区别

Teradata和PouchDB都是数据库管理系统,但它们的设计目的、功能、运行环境以及适用场景等方面都有所不同。

## 设计目的

Teradata是企业级数据仓库解决方案,旨在处理大量复杂的数据。它支持海量数据的存储、处理和分析,并提供了强大的数据集成、数据分析和数据可视化的功能。

PouchDB则是一种轻量级的本地数据库,适用于在Web和移动应用中存储和管理数据。它可以在浏览器、Node.js和移动设备等各种平台上运行,支持跨平台数据同步和离线数据访问等特性。

## 功能

Teradata拥有丰富的功能,包括数据存储、数据管理、数据分析、数据挖掘、数据可视化等。它能够对多种类型的数据进行复杂的查询与处理,并支持高速数据加载、数据备份、数据恢复等重要功能。

PouchDB虽然是一种轻量级的本地数据库,但也具备了一些重要的功能,如索引、事务、数据复制等。它还支持复杂查询和地理空间查询等高级功能,可以通过插件扩展更多功能。

## 运行环境

Teradata是一种客户端-服务器架构的数据库系统,需要安装在专门的服务器上。它需要强大的硬件支持,如多处理器、高速存储器和大容量存储器等。

PouchDB则可以在客户端或者服务器端运行,不需要特殊的硬件和软件环境。它可以和多种Web和移动应用框架配合使用,如Angular、React、Vue、Ionic等。

## 适用场景

Teradata适用于需要处理海量、复杂数据的企业级应用场景,如金融、保险、医疗、物流等行业。它可以帮助企业快速、精确地分析数据,提高业务决策效率和精度。

PouchDB适用于需要在Web和移动应用中管理数据的场景。它可以作为浏览器端的本地数据库,实现数据的高速存储和查询。它也可以作为移动端应用的本地数据库,实现离线数据存储和同步。同时,PouchDB还支持与服务器端数据库进行同步和数据复制,实现端到端的数据同步。

## 结论

Teradata和PouchDB都是很好的数据库管理系统,但它们的设计目的、功能、运行环境以及适用场景等方面都有所不同。开发者们可以根据自己项目的需求来选择最符合自己的数据库系统。